CARMI AND MT. CARMEL PIZZA HUTS CLOSE ABRUPTLY, LEAVING EMPLOYEES AND COMMUNITY SHOCKED

By Mark Wells Nov 14, 2025 | 5:58 AM

Two local Pizza Hut restaurants have closed their doors, including the Carmi location that was recently honored as the Carmi Chamber of Commerce Business of the Year just over a month ago. The Mt. Carmel Pizza Hut, owned by the same franchisee, was closed suddenly last Saturday. Now, the Carmi restaurant is also permanently closed as of 10 p.m. Wednesday night.

Brittany Rutledge, the Carmi store’s manager since May 2024, said the staff was heartbroken to receive the news during a meeting Wednesday evening. Another employee, one of approximately twenty affected, explained that staff were told last Thursday about a mandatory meeting scheduled for Wednesday, which would include the district manager.

Despite the staff’s dedication and recent attempts to revitalize the business, financial realities ultimately led to the closure. According to employees, the restaurant required an estimated $250,000 remodel, and would have needed to increase daily revenue by $1,500 to pay off the investment within a reasonable timeframe.

Some displaced employees may have the opportunity to transfer to the Pizza Hut in Harrisburg.
